Pisco is a grape brandy and can just be made in either Peru or Chile (both highly declare it comes from them, and a lot of pisco enthusiasts have a choice. It can end up being rather a heated up subject so I will leave it at that!). Pisco has a smooth taste with tips of grape and apple, it likewise has a light natural earthiness to it that I would compare to tequila– nevertheless Pisco is absolutely distinct and any contrast to another spirit will definitely stop working.

And how could you not enjoy The Cupid’s Cup? The Aperol not just cancels the sour notes with a little bitterness, however it likewise provides it that stunning orange/peach colour. I have actually utilized both lime and lemon juice in this mixed drink dish, and I enjoy it both methods however somewhat choose the more sour lemon juice. A conventional Pisco Sour is made with fresh lime juice (really, the Peruvian dish requires limones, which resemble crucial limes) however given that we’re currently straying the pisco sour course, we’re choosing lemon juice in this dish.

The Cupid’s Cup

Yield 1 mixed drink

A scrumptious Pisco Sour variation made with Aperol. This basic pisco beverage is a little sour and a little bitter, the best balance

Components

  • 1.5 oz Pisco
  • 1 oz Aperol
  • 1 oz Fresh Lemon Juice
  • 1 oz Simple Syrup
  • 1 Egg White *
  • Fresh Mint Leaves for garnish

Directions

  1. Put all the components, other than the mint leaves, in a mixed drink shaker and dry shake intensely for one minute.
  2. Include 5 ice and shake once again, up until you can feel the shaker get cold
  3. Pour into cooled coupe or martini glass
  4. Location a mint leaf in between on your palm and clap your other hand flat on top – this carefully contusions it and assist launch aromatic oils. Put on top of the white foam.

Notes

* I advise fresh egg whites for texture, however if you’re fretted about raw egg you can utilize pasteurised egg whites from a container
